- Damis AmisJul 05, 2024 · a year agoIt's unfortunate that your cryptocurrency wallet keeps getting hacked. There could be several reasons for this. One possibility is that your wallet's security measures are not strong enough. It's important to use a wallet that has robust security features, such as multi-factor authentication and encryption. Additionally, make sure to keep your wallet software up to date, as developers often release security patches to address vulnerabilities. Another reason could be that you're being targeted by hackers. They may be using phishing emails, malware, or other tactics to gain access to your wallet. It's crucial to be vigilant and avoid clicking on suspicious links or downloading unknown files. Lastly, consider the possibility that your computer or device is compromised. Ensure that you have reliable antivirus software installed and regularly scan for malware. It's also a good idea to use a dedicated device for your cryptocurrency activities, separate from your everyday computer. By taking these precautions, you can significantly reduce the risk of your wallet being hacked.
- Mihajlo ZivkovicSep 06, 2021 · 4 years agoOh no, not again! It's frustrating when your cryptocurrency wallet keeps getting hacked. The most common reason for this is poor security practices. Are you using a weak password? Hackers can easily crack simple passwords, so make sure to use a strong, unique password for your wallet. Another possibility is that you're falling for phishing scams. Be cautious of emails or messages asking for your wallet information or private keys. Legitimate companies will never ask for this information. Additionally, consider using a hardware wallet for added security. These devices store your private keys offline, making it much harder for hackers to access them. Don't forget to regularly update your wallet software and enable two-factor authentication for an extra layer of protection. Stay safe out there!

- Er1c Brow0Mar 09, 2022 · 4 years agoGetting your cryptocurrency wallet hacked can be a nightmare. One possible reason is that you're using a centralized exchange wallet. These wallets are more susceptible to hacking attempts as they store a large number of users' funds in a single location. Consider using a decentralized wallet instead, where you have full control over your private keys. Another reason could be that you're using an outdated wallet software version. Developers regularly release updates to fix security vulnerabilities, so make sure to keep your wallet software up to date. It's also important to avoid downloading wallet software from unofficial sources, as they may contain malware. Lastly, double-check the security of your computer or device. Ensure that you have a reliable antivirus program installed and be cautious when connecting to public Wi-Fi networks. By taking these precautions, you can minimize the risk of your cryptocurrency wallet getting hacked.
